Obtaining a CDL: How does one do?

Where: Community College, Vocation Specific School (i.e. Trucker School)

How: Savings motherfucker, or financing - some schools finance, there's financial aid if you can go to a comm. college, banks hand out loans for CDL training all the time because lots of companies will pay it for you once you're hired.

>>16208534
You could start working in the warehouse and constantly ask for driver position openings.

Go for a commission based job rather than hourly. If you're hourly, enjoy working 12+ hour shifts 5 days a week and be fired for being even 5 minutes off schedule. Commission based, you basically have your route and you get it done on your own schedule. If you want to take 12 hours wasting time, then you aren't getting paid extra. Best to get it done ASAP. Might not be as great as hourly because of all the over time pay, but you have more freedom. I know a guy that makes ~$45K doing local delivery. Usually leaves for work around 5:30-6:00 int he morning. Starts his delivery around 7:00AM and is done by noon or a litter later if he's running extra deliveries for somebody who called out. He enjoys his work/life balance and I'm sure his family does too. His wife is a nurse, so combined they do pretty well with 2 kids.

>>16209951

Git gud at double clutching first, then worry about floating later, that way you have a good base since floating gears smoothly is a skill that takes a lot of practice.

Personally, I often float up in gears, and double clutch on the way down, especially when coming to a stop, but you'll figure out what works for you and the truck you're in.

>>16210333

Highly unlikely for several reasons.

Extreme shortage of drivers means that oftentimes contractors are forced to hire less-than-ideal applicants. I see this all the time, we hire complete morons that shouldn't be driving anything and 2 days out of training they're given the keys to a brand new $100K Bluebird school bus and entrusted with the safety of 60 kids.

The school bus contract business is very cuttthroat with razor thin profit margins. The trend is going towards mega companies that have dozens of terminals scattered across entire regions. Quality suffers when they're always looking for ways to cut costs.
